Tuna Salad Sicilian Style

Transform your mealtime with the vibrant flavors of Tuna Salad Sicilian Style, a Mediterranean-inspired dish that’s as refreshing as it is satisfying. This quick and easy recipe combines tender flaked tuna, sweet cherry tomatoes, crisp cucumber, and tangy red onion with briny kalamata olives, capers, and fragrant fresh herbs like parsley and basil. A simple yet zesty dressing of extra virgin olive oil, red wine vinegar, and lemon juice ties it all together, creating a light and flavorful salad that’s perfect for lunch or dinner. Serve it on its own, with crusty bread, or atop a bed of mixed greens for a healthy, protein-packed meal bursting with bold, sunny Italian flavors. Prep Time:15 mins
Cook Time:0 mins
Total Time:15 mins
Servings: 4

Ingredients

  • 2 cans (5 oz each) canned tuna (in olive oil, drained)
  • 1 cup cherry tomatoes
  • 1 medium (diced) cucumber
  • 1 small (thinly sliced) red onion
  • 0.5 cup kalamata olives
  • 2 tablespoons capers
  • 0.25 cup (chopped) fresh parsley
  • 0.25 cup (torn) fresh basil leaves
  • 3 tablespoons extra virgin olive oil
  • 1.5 tablespoons red wine vinegar
  • 1 tablespoon lemon juice
  • 0.5 teaspoon salt
  • 0.25 teaspoon ground black pepper
  • 0 crusty bread or mixed greens (optional, for serving)

Directions

Step 1

Drain the canned tuna thoroughly and transfer it to a large mixing bowl. Flake the tuna gently with a fork.

Step 2

Halve the cherry tomatoes and dice the cucumber. Add them to the mixing bowl along with the sliced red onion.

Step 3

Pit and halve the kalamata olives, then add them to the bowl along with the capers.

Step 4

Chop the fresh parsley and tear the basil leaves. Add both to the salad mixture.

Step 5

In a small bowl, whisk together the extra virgin olive oil, red wine vinegar, lemon juice, salt, and pepper to create the dressing.

Step 6

Pour the dressing over the salad and gently toss everything together until well combined.

Step 7

Taste and adjust seasoning, adding more salt, pepper, or lemon juice if needed.

Step 8

Serve the Tuna Salad Sicilian Style on its own, with crusty bread, or over a bed of mixed greens. Enjoy!
